Transaction 68a35ef384b1e3631739295aba5399431b58631b8a7512fc87d64e07639fad45
1 Input
1 Output
-
68a35ef384b1e3631739295aba5399431b58631b8a7512fc87d64e07639fad45:0
- value
- 663086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b47e40f89437742b86f74d5866d407de462c2339 OP_EQUAL
- address
- 3J9NoLhtFHKfCfGgFzCq4XHt4umit8UL3a